Introduction to the Major
With the continuous increase in the world's population and the improvement of living standards, the demand for aquatic products is growing. However, due to overexploitation, aquatic resources are becoming increasingly scarce, and the growth of aquatic products can only rely on aquaculture. China is a major aquaculture country, accounting for about 67% of the world's total aquaculture output. The development space is expanding, and the demand for talent is also increasing annually.
In recent years, the country has increasingly demanded high-level innovative talents who can lead the industry towards modernization, centralization, and green sustainable development. The main purpose of the Aquaculture major is to provide excellent professional talents for production, research, management, and education departments in the fisheries field. It can be predicted that the employment prospects for graduates of the Aquaculture major will continue to improve.

Main Subjects
Main subjects and core professional courses:
- Main Subjects: Aquaculture, Biology, Environmental Science
- Core Professional Courses: Aquatic Animal Histology and Embryology, Ichthyology, Malacology, Crustacean Biology, Genetics, Microbiology, Hydrobiology, Aquatic Animal Husbandry, Aquaculture Environmental Chemistry, Aquatic Animal Physiology, Fish Culture, Crustacean Culture, Marine Mollusk Culture, Aquatic Animal Nutrition and Feed, Live Feed Culture, Aquatic Animal Pathology.

Career Opportunities
Currently, graduates of the Aquaculture major can engage in technical promotion, market development, aquatic product trade, inspection and quarantine, ornamental fish evaluation, teaching and research, administrative management, and other work in fields such as marine science, aquaculture, aquatic animal medicine, etc. They can start their own businesses or pursue further studies in marine science, aquaculture, veterinary medicine, biology, environmental science, and related fields.

Assessment of the Aquaculture Major
The Aquaculture major is an important field in the national economy, especially in countries with abundant water resources like China.
This industry focuses on cultivating aquatic species in saltwater, freshwater, and brackish water environments through the application of advanced and safe production techniques. Students in this major will be equipped with knowledge about aquaculture management, breeding selection, disease prevention and treatment, and aquatic nutrition and feed. Additionally, they will learn about pond, lake, and other ecological environment management technologies.
